If you have ever visited a blog you may have noticed ads in their posts, sidebar, or even as a popup. This is called pay-per-click advertising, also referred to as PPC, this form of ad involves installing code onto your website or blog that displays ads that are targeted to the keywords in your content. You have the opportunity to earn a commission each time a reader clicks on the ads. This option is relatively easy to get started with and can earn a significant income if you approach it with strategy and research. How Pay-Per-Click Advertising Works

Pay-per-click advertising is sometimes referred to as cost per click ads (CCP). PPC is an advertising system in which advertisers pay publishers when their ads are clicked.

The process is simple, you’ll place display ad code on your site which will automatically generate ads based on your current content. This ensures the ads will be relevant to your users, thus increasing the chances of ads receiving clicks. The benefit of PPC for advertisers is that it generates traffic to their site or preferred destination. The clicks also allow them to determine which ads are working and to gauge user engagement.

 

Pay-Per-Click Networks

There are a number of networks that will allow you to place PPC ads on your site. The best known of these is definitely Google AdSense. Google is, of course, the largest search engine in the world. There’s plenty of ads available and Google’s algorithm is pretty good about matching ads to your content. There are other, smaller networks to consider.

PPC networks gaining in popularity include:

  • Bidvertiser
  • AdRoll
  • RevContent
  • AdBlade
  • Clicksor

Payouts with smaller sites like this, however, can be smaller than with larger networks. This may be something to consider when deciding which one is right for you. In addition, each has their own criteria for publisher acceptance. You may not qualify for each network. Take some time to research which might be a good fit.

 

What to Know

Getting started is relatively easy. Determine which network or networks appeal to you and apply. Once you’re accepted, you can access a code to place in your sidebar or other location on your blog. Ads will automatically be generated and tracked using this code. It’s a passive way to earn income. There’s no need to reach out to direct advertisers or manage payouts. That’s all done for you.

I did want to add that these networks don’t just accept everyone that applies. So I wanted to give you some quick tips that can help to increase your odds of being accepted to a network. Make sure your blog looks as clean and appealing as possible. Also, it’s important that you’re posting content on a regular basis. Having an inactive blog is a sure way to get denied.

Once you are accepted and place your ads, you may wish to try different placements over time in order to see which converts to clicks better. Also, keep ads to a minimum to avoid being spammy. Don’t place any more than three campaigns per page.

Now that you know a little bit about what PPC is and how it works, you’re ready to give it a shot. One word of warning, it’s not likely you’ll make a ton of money right away. It takes time to build momentum. The best way to earn big with PPC is to have a large audience. However, it’s an easy and accessible way to begin in the world of blog monetizing.
